Has anyone ported elm or some other (friendlier?) mail user agent to the
MIPS?  mailx or gnu are okay for me, but I have users that would appreciate
something a little easier to use.

I am willing to do the port, but if someone else has already done the work and
is willing to share......

On our DECstation 3100, elm 2.2 just recompiled and flies under UWS 2.0
(Ultrix 3.0).

There is no porting involved.  Elm runs as is on our 3.10 system.
